Half Birthday SVG: What Exactly Are They?

Alright, let's start with the basics. What exactly is a Half Birthday SVG file? Well, SVG stands for Scalable Vector Graphics. In simple terms, it's a type of image file that can be scaled up or down without losing any quality. Unlike raster images (like JPEGs or PNGs), which become pixelated when enlarged, SVGs maintain their crispness. This is super important when you're creating designs for different projects, from small stickers to large banners. Think of it like this: you can blow up an SVG to the size of a billboard, and it will still look perfect. That's the magic of vector graphics!

Decoding SVG: The Techy Side

For those of you who love a bit of tech talk, let's delve a little deeper into the technical side of SVG files. As vector graphics, SVGs are created using mathematical equations that define the shapes and lines of the design. When you scale an SVG, the software simply recalculates these equations to maintain the image's clarity. This is in contrast to raster images, which store information as a grid of pixels. When you enlarge a raster image, the software has to guess at what the new pixels should look like, leading to a loss of quality. SVGs are also typically smaller in file size compared to raster images, making them easier to store and share. They support a wide range of features, including gradients, transparency, and animations, opening up even more creative opportunities. These features mean you can create complex and visually stunning designs that are perfect for a variety of projects. The code behind an SVG is written in XML, which makes it easy to edit and customize the design to your specific needs. Many graphic design programs, like Adobe Illustrator, Inkscape (a free option), and even some online design tools, allow you to open and modify SVG files. Cutting and Using Your Half Birthday SVGs

Now that you've found and chosen your Half Birthday SVG designs, and figured out what to make with them, let's walk through the process of cutting and using these files with your cutting machine. Knowing how to work with these files is key to achieving those amazing results.

Software Setup and Preparation

Before you can cut anything, you'll need to set up your cutting machine's software. Most cutting machines, like Cricut and Silhouette, come with their own software programs (Cricut Design Space and Silhouette Studio, respectively). These programs allow you to upload, manipulate, and cut your Half Birthday SVG files. First, install the software on your computer and create an account. Then, upload your SVG file into the software. Most software programs are designed to work with SVGs directly, so the process is usually straightforward. You may need to adjust the size, position, and color of the design within the software. Take the time to familiarize yourself with the software's features and tools. This includes learning how to group and ungroup elements, weld or weld objects, and select the right cutting materials. Proper software setup is essential for a smooth cutting experience.

Cutting Machine Basics and Settings

Once your design is prepared in the software, it's time to set up your cutting machine. Make sure your machine is properly connected to your computer and that the blade is correctly installed. The key to successful cutting is using the correct settings for your chosen material. Cutting machines offer a wide variety of material settings, and you must choose the correct one for your project. This includes selecting the type of material, such as vinyl, cardstock, or HTV, and adjusting the blade depth, pressure, and speed. The manufacturer's recommendations provide the optimal settings for your specific material. Remember to do a test cut to ensure that the settings are correct before cutting the full design. This helps you to avoid wasting materials and ensures a clean, precise cut. With the right settings, your cutting machine can precisely create your desired designs.

Weeding and Application Techniques

After the cutting is complete, you'll need to weed the design. Weeding involves removing the excess material from around the cut-out design. This is usually done using a weeding tool or a craft knife. After weeding, the design is ready for application. The application technique will depend on the project and the material you're using. For HTV, you'll use a heat press or iron to adhere the design to the fabric. For vinyl, you'll use transfer tape to transfer the design onto the surface. For paper projects, you can use glue or adhesive to attach the cut-out shapes. Ensure you carefully follow the instructions for your specific materials and application method. Troubleshooting Common SVG Issues

Even though Half Birthday SVG files are generally user-friendly, you might encounter some issues during the process. No worries, though! Here's a quick guide to troubleshoot some common problems and get your crafting projects back on track.

Design Not Uploading Properly

Sometimes, your SVG file might not upload correctly into your cutting machine's software. This can be frustrating, but there are a few things you can try. Make sure the file is in the correct SVG format. Verify that the file isn't corrupted. Try downloading the file again from your source. Check the software for any compatibility issues. If the problem persists, you might need to convert the file to a different format or try a different software program. Usually, simply re-downloading the file or checking the format solves the problem. Keep your patience and experiment with different solutions to ensure your designs upload properly.

Cutting Machine Errors and Solutions

Your cutting machine might give you errors during the cutting process. Check the blade and ensure it is installed correctly. Make sure the cutting mat is clean and in good condition. Adjust the settings for your material. Sometimes, the blade is not sharp enough, or the pressure is too high or too low. If the machine starts to make strange noises or the cut is not clean, stop immediately. Always be sure to do test cuts before attempting to cut the design. Also, keep the machine clean and well-maintained to avoid any hardware problems. Identifying and solving cutting machine errors can be a bit of a trial and error process. With a little persistence, you can overcome these errors and create flawless projects.

Material Adhesion and Application Problems

If your design doesn't stick to the material properly, or if it's not adhering correctly, there are several things to check. Ensure that you are using the correct type of adhesive and that the surface is clean and dry. Use the appropriate heat settings for HTV and apply enough pressure. If you're using vinyl, make sure the transfer tape is the right type for the material you're using. The problems can be resolved by careful attention to detail. You must always read the instructions before starting your project. These include applying even pressure, using a heat press at the correct temperature, and ensuring the material is properly prepped. Sometimes, the problem may be due to a faulty product. Always test your materials on scrap pieces before starting the actual project.

What are the best software programs for working with SVG files?

The most popular software programs are Cricut Design Space, Silhouette Studio, Adobe Illustrator, and Inkscape. Cricut Design Space and Silhouette Studio are specifically designed for cutting machines. Adobe Illustrator is a professional-grade design program, while Inkscape is a free and open-source alternative.

Where can I find free Half Birthday SVG designs?

You can find free designs on websites like Design Bundles, Creative Fabrica, and various crafting blogs. Always check the licensing agreements before using these designs for commercial purposes.

What materials can I use with Half Birthday SVG files?

You can use SVG files with a variety of materials, including vinyl, heat transfer vinyl (HTV), cardstock, and even wood.

How do I apply HTV to a t-shirt?

You'll need a heat press or an iron. Place the design on your t-shirt, cover it with a protective sheet, and apply heat according to the HTV manufacturer's instructions.

What are the best tips for successful weeding?

Use a sharp weeding tool, work on a well-lit surface, and take your time. Consider using a light pad to make it easier to see the cut lines.
